In this episode, Brian sits down with Janice Kephart, a national security and identity expert who has spent over two decades shaping identity policy and biometric solutions. Janice served as border counsel to the 9/11 Commission and has testified before the US Congress and the United Nations. Now, she's building ZipID—a groundbreaking identity authentication platform that simplifies compliance and solves a major pain point for employers. Janice’s story is a powerful example of how to apply entrepreneurial thinking to complex problems, and how creative problem-solving can drive business success.

📝 About Janice Kephart

Janice Kephart is a national security and identity expert with over 20 years of experience in identity policy and biometric solutions. She served as border counsel to the 9/11 Commission and has testified before the US Congress and the UN on identity and national security issues. Janice is the CEO of Identity Strategy Partners and the founder of ZipID, a compliance-focused identity verification platform designed to simplify hiring and employee authentication. A creative at heart, Janice is also a spoken word artist and narrator, blending her legal expertise with innovative thinking.
